This invention describes an oral pill designed to treat or prevent heart and kidney disease, or diabetes. It combines a specific amount of bromide, like sodium or potassium bromide, with one or more existing drugs for these conditions. The pill is precisely formulated to consist only of these ingredients and a carrier.
Why it matters: Clinical efficacy and safety for this specific drug combination remains the primary hurdle, requiring extensive trials and regulatory approval.
